Call for abstracts: 2016 Gordon early-career Seminar (GRS) & Conference
(GRC) Origins of Life.
January 16-17 & 18-22, 2016, Hotel Galvez, Galveston, Texas.

In 2016
​,​
the GRS will focus on the question: what would it take for the emerging
generation of researchers to go from a collage of individual achievements
to a real breakthrough in understanding life's origins - presently one of
the greatest mysteries of science? This graduate seminar will bring
together students and early-careers from diverse backgrounds in order to
promote discussions and collaborations in the interdisciplinary connections
that can catalyze such thinking.

Abstracts for talks and posters should be submitted by following this
website: http://www.grc.org/programs.aspx?id=17244 , deadline is *October
16, 2015.*
